Primary Services Provided by Property Management Firms

Property management companies offer a variety of solutions that cover every aspect of managing rentals and tenant interactions.

Their key offerings include:

  • • Renter Screening and Background Checks: Firms thoroughly assess applicants to guarantee a secure and dependable community for every inhabitant.
  • • Rent Collection and Financial Reporting: Routine rental income gathering and comprehensive financial reports assist property owners in monitoring revenue.
  • • Maintenance and Repair Coordination: Regular maintenance and timely repairs ensure that problems are resolved promptly, resulting in tenant satisfaction.
  • • Lease Agreement Preparation and Enforcement: Meticulously prepared lease documents safeguard all parties by establishing explicit expectations and duties.

Each of these services is designed to save time, reduce stress, and ensure that the property complies with local laws and regulations. This makes professional management a smart choice for those with rental houses.

Inquiries to Pose Prior to Engaging a Property Manager

Before committing to a property management firm, prospective clients should ask a few critical questions:

  • • What is your tenant screening process?

    Understanding their process helps ensure they find reliable renters.

  • • How do you manage repairs and maintenance?

    Knowing their response time and methods gives confidence in managing emergencies.

  • • How are rent payments collected and reported?

    Straightforward financial processes ensure transparency and simplify income tracking.

  • • Are there any additional fees or hidden costs?

    A breakdown of costs helps avoid surprises down the line.

These questions help property owners make informed decisions that align with their needs and expectations.
